Head-Related Transfer Function - an overview - ScienceDirect
This is called the head-related impulse response (HRIR) and its Fourier transform, H (f), is the head-related transfer function (HRTF). Once the HRTF is known for each ear we can reproduce a binaural signal from a monaural signal.

HRTF Explained | Acoustic Accuracy, 3D Audio & Immersion
2024年5月28日 · An HRTF is essentially a mathematical model that represents how sound waves interact with the human anatomy (the head, ears, and torso) before reaching the eardrum. Each individual has a unique HRTF that affects how they perceive the direction and distance of sounds.
